The Army is merely nothing---positive zero!" "Laughing good-humoredly, Greg piloted Belle up the long, winding walk that leads to the West Point plain.
Dick and Laura soon fell in behind, at some distance, walking very slowly. "Did you have a tiresome trip here ?" inquired Dick. "No; a very pleasant one," Laura replied. "I should think a long journey would be tedious to women traveling without male escort," Dick went on. "We had escort as far as New York," Laura replied promptly. "Oh, you did ?" inquired Prescott, feeling a swift sinking at heart. "Yes; Mr.Cameron had to make a flying trip to New York.
He had to come at about this time, so he put it off for three or four days in order to travel through with us.
Wasn't that nice of him ?" "Extremely nice of him," admitted the cadet rather huskily.
"I---I suppose he will return with you from New York." "We expect him to," Laura admitted.
